What is fotor and why you might want to cancel

Fotor is an online photo-editing and design platform that combines image editing tools, design templates, and AI-powered features into one accessible service. The platform offers both free and premium (Fotor Pro) subscription tiers, with the paid plan unlocking advanced editing capabilities, cloud storage, and a broader template library.

You can access Fotor through your web browser, on Android via Google Play, or on iOS and macOS through the App Store. Many users in India subscribe to Fotor Pro for design work, social media content creation, or personal photo editing-but life changes, budget constraints, or shifting creative tools often make cancellation necessary.

How to cancel fotor: methods by platform

Cancellation steps vary depending on where you purchased your subscription. Follow the method that matches your situation.

Cancel through the fotor website

If you purchased Fotor Pro directly from fotor.com, use this method to cancel from your browser on desktop or mobile.

  1. Log into your Fotor account at fotor.com using your email and password.
  2. Click your account avatar or profile icon in the top-right corner of the page.
  3. Select "Account Settings" from the dropdown menu.
  4. Navigate to "Subscription" or "Plans" in the left sidebar.
  5. Click "Manage Plan" or "Manage Subscription" (wording varies by account age).
  6. Review your current plan details and find the cancellation or downgrade option.
    • If you see "Cancel Subscription," click it directly.
    • If the button says "Downgrade to free plan," selecting this will end your paid access at the end of your current billing cycle.
  7. Confirm your cancellation by clicking "Yes, cancel my subscription" or similar confirmation button.
  8. Fotor will display a cancellation confirmation message and send a confirmation email to your registered address.
  9. Save this email as proof of cancellation for your records.

Warning: Some older Fotor accounts may use a different interface. If you don't see "Subscription" in Account Settings, look for "Billing," "Orders," or "Payment Methods" instead.

Cancel through google play (Android)

If you subscribed to Fotor via the Google Play Store on your Android device, you must cancel through Google Play-not through the Fotor app itself.

  1. Open the Google Play Store app on your Android device.
  2. Tap your profile icon in the top-right corner.
  3. Select "Manage your Google Account."
  4. Tap the "Payments and subscriptions" tab at the top.
  5. Tap "Subscriptions."
  6. Find and select "Fotor" or "Goart - Photo Editor" (Fotor's older app name) from the list.
    • If you see multiple entries, select the one matching your current subscription.
  7. Tap "Cancel subscription" at the bottom of the screen.
  8. Follow the prompts to confirm cancellation. Google will ask why you're cancelling-provide feedback if you wish, but it's optional.
  9. You'll receive an email confirmation from Google; save this for your records.
  10. Your access to Fotor Pro will end at the end of your current billing period, and you won't be charged again.

Pro tip: You can also manage Google Play subscriptions through a web browser at myaccount.google.com/subscriptions. This method is often faster than using the mobile app.

Cancel through the app store (iOS and macOS)

If you subscribed to Fotor through Apple's App Store on your iPhone, iPad, or Mac, cancel through your Apple account settings.

  1. Open the App Store on your iOS device or Mac.
  2. Tap or click your profile icon in the top-right corner (the silhouette or your profile photo).
  3. Select "Subscriptions" from the menu.
  4. Find "Fotor" or "Goart - Photo Editor" in your active subscriptions list and tap it.
  5. Tap "Manage Subscription" or "Edit Subscription."
  6. Scroll down and select "Cancel Subscription."
  7. Choose a reason for cancellation from the dropdown (optional but helpful for Apple).
  8. Confirm your cancellation by tapping "Confirm" or "Cancel Subscription" again.
  9. Apple will send an email confirmation to your registered Apple ID email address.
  10. Your subscription will end on the last day of your current billing period.

Warning: Do not delete the Fotor app after cancelling-deletion is separate from cancellation, and deleting the app does not stop subscription charges.

What happens after you cancel fotor

Knowing what to expect after pressing cancel helps you avoid confusion and protects your account access during the transition.

Immediate changes and access

When you cancel Fotor Pro, your paid features remain active until the end of your current billing period. If you paid for an annual plan in January, your cancellation takes effect at the end of December-not immediately. This grace period allows you to complete ongoing projects before losing access to premium tools.

After your final billing date passes, your account automatically downgrades to the free Fotor plan. You retain access to all your previous projects, but you can no longer use premium features like unlimited cloud storage, advanced AI tools, or the ability to export without watermarks.

Your account, projects, and data

Cancelling your subscription does not delete your Fotor account or any projects you've created. Your designs, photos, and edits remain saved in your account indefinitely, according to Fotor's data retention policy. You can log back in and access these projects at any time-even after downgrading to free.

However, if Fotor closes your account due to inactivity (typically 12 months of no login), your data may be deleted. Additionally, if you paid for cloud storage as part of Fotor Pro and your subscription ends, you lose access to that premium storage space. Download or export any important projects before your subscription ends to avoid this issue.

Pro tip: Export all your projects to your device or cloud storage (Google Drive, OneDrive, etc.) at least one week before your subscription ends. This ensures you have a backup copy and aren't dependent on Fotor's servers.

Refund policy and how to request money back

Fotor's stated refund policy differs based on where you purchased your subscription, but Indian consumer law may override their terms in your favour.

Direct purchases from fotor's website

Fotor's website refund policy states that subscriptions are non-refundable once purchased. This applies to both annual and monthly plans bought directly from fotor.com. However, this policy does not automatically prevent you from requesting a refund if you have grounds under consumer protection law.

Request a refund by contacting Fotor support directly-explain why you believe you deserve one (service not delivered as advertised, unauthorized charge, etc.). Stopee recommends being specific: reference your order date, transaction ID (from your payment confirmation email), and the reason for your request.

Subscriptions purchased via google play or app store

If you bought Fotor Pro through Google Play or the App Store, Google and Apple's refund policies apply instead of Fotor's. Both platforms offer a 48-hour window to request a refund after purchase-but only if you haven't used the service extensively.

For Google Play: Visit your Google Play order history, select the Fotor transaction, and request a refund. Google typically processes these within 2-3 business days.

For App Store: Go to your App Store purchase history, select the Fotor purchase, and tap "Report a Problem." Choose a reason (service not as described, accidental purchase, etc.) and request a refund. Apple usually responds within 48 hours.

Pro tip: If you're outside the 48-hour window but believe you have a legitimate complaint, contact support anyway. Platform refund policies are guidelines, not absolute rules, and both Google and Apple often grant exceptions for billing errors or service failures.

Free trial cancellation and premature charging

Fotor offers a 7-day free trial for new accounts (one trial per email address). If you activated the free trial but cancelled before the 7 days ended, you should not have been charged. If you were charged despite cancelling during the trial period, this is a billing error.

Contact Fotor support immediately with proof of your cancellation (screenshot of the confirmation message or email) and your payment confirmation. Request a full refund for the unauthorized charge. Stopee advises acting within 30 days of the unexpected charge for faster resolution.

Common cancellation mistakes to avoid

Cancellation is straightforward, but small oversights can leave you paying longer than necessary or unable to access your projects when you need them. Here's what to watch out for.

Deleting the app instead of cancelling the subscription

This is the most common error. Deleting the Fotor app from your device does absolutely nothing to stop your subscription-charges continue as usual. Your subscription exists in your app store account or at fotor.com, not on your phone. You must cancel through the account settings of your chosen platform.

Cancelling mid-year and losing your annual payment

If you paid for an annual plan and cancel in month 4, you do not get an automatic refund for the remaining 8 months. Fotor does not prorate refunds. If you need to cancel early, contact support and ask about switching to a monthly plan instead-some users report success, though it's not guaranteed.

Forgetting to export projects before the subscription ends

Once your Fotor Pro access expires, you lose the ability to export high-resolution files without watermarks. Download all projects in full quality before your final billing date. You can still access projects in the free plan, but exports will be limited and watermarked.

Not saving the cancellation confirmation email

If Fotor later claims you never cancelled and charges you again, your confirmation email is your proof. Without it, disputing the charge becomes harder. Save every confirmation message Fotor and your app store send you.
